The Dutch Oven workshop will be Saturday afternoon, starting at 2:00pm. We'll be discussing equipment, tools, fuel, tips and techniques, followed by a hands-on making of a separate recipe for each Dutch Oven. The food should be ready about 5:00, at which time we'll enjoy a sampling of all that you have cooked.

We will contact each of you who sign up to match you up with a recipe that fits your experience and interest. You'll bring your Dutch Oven, the ingredients for your recipe, some charcoal, and be ready to have a good time. If you don't have a Dutch Oven, and want to participate, you may be able to borrow one for the class.
